The Nexa(R) RM Series is modular and its power output is scalable in 1 kW increments to meet individual customer requirements.

Ballard has delivered Nexa(R) RM systems for utility and server room UPS field trials and has scheduled deliveries for telecommunications field trials before year-end. The scalability of the product in 1 kW increments provides the versatility to meet application specific load requirements across the power range. For telecom, the typical application is in the range of 5 kW to 20 kW."

"We see strong potential for fuel cell systems in mission critical applications where long back-up times are required," said Jack Pouchet, MGE's Director of Marketing. "MGE will conduct UPS field trials using our existing conventional powered products integrated with Ballard's Nexa(R) RM Series cells. It is our intention to include Ballard(R) fuel cells in our 2004 product line."

Nexa(R) RM Series prototype systems are now available for sale for additional field trials. Ballard plans to bring production units of Nexa(R) RM Series to the market in 2004 upon completion of the ongoing field trials.

MGE is a world leader in providing high quality power solutions that increase power availability and system uptime to PCs and enterprise-wide networks, mission-critical telecommunication systems, and industrial/manufacturing processes. MGE's comprehensive product offering includes UPSs, inverters, rectifiers, power management software, active harmonic conditioners, and surge suppressors that provide MGE's customers with end-to-end infrastructure solutions. With its Total Quality Management and MGE PowerServices(TM) programs, supported by a network of 900 service specialists in 170 centers worldwide, MGE's customers are assured of the highest-level of quality and service throughout the complete life-cycle of their installations.

Ballard is partnering with strong, world-leading companies, including DaimlerChrysler, Ford, EBARA, ALSTOM and FirstEnergy, to commercialize Ballard(R) fuel cells. Ballard has supplied fuel cells to Honda, Mitsubishi, Nissan, Volkswagen, Yamaha and Cinergy, among others.
